Georg Hartner
Georg is working for Austrian Energy Association, EU DSO Entity and GEODE and is a key contributor to the Implementing Acts on Data Interoperability in our sector. He is also vice-chair of EU DSO Entity’s Expert Group Data Interoperability and – as a member of Expert Group Distributed Flexibility – part of the development team for the SO proposal for a new Network Code on Demand Response. He contributes to continuously improving energy data exchange in Austria in co-operation with EDA GmbH. Accompanying these work streams, Georg is co-initiator and Technical Coordinator of Horizon Europe – funded “Project EDDIE – European Distributed Data Infrastructure for Energy”, which will make available European retail energy data easily available through a de-centralised uniform interface. Recently, he co-initiated the works on upcoming Project INSIEME on the deployment of the Common European Energy Data Space, in which about 60 European partner companies operationalise the components and services to make streamlined energy data exchange work for a digital, flexible and participative energy system.
